I am having one problem with the carb. When I accelerate from idle (especially when cold), it wants to stall. I have to feather the throttle or punch it to get it past this stumble. Once it is moving, there is no hesitation in the throttle. Any suggestions???

But that sounds like you may need to adjust the choke a little, or let that engine have a little more time to warm up before you take off.

Also check your vacuum lines for leaks, you can spray Wd-40 around the connections and wait, if your engine speeds up, you have a leak
If your carburetor has multiple positions on the accelerator pump, go to the position that will give more fuel when the throttle is opened. If the carb has never been rebuilt, it is probably due for a rebuild with components that are tolerant to ethanol fuels.
